Marvell, E Ink Introduce New E-book Reader Chip
Santa Clara,
Calif. - Marvell, a provider of
storage, communications and consumer silicon technology, and partner E Ink on
Tuesday announced the launch of a new line of semiconductors aimed at the
e-book reader market.
The ARMADA eReader chip supports technologies including
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, 3G modem and power management.
The companies expect consumer
e-book readers equipped with their chip to come to market in 2010, in devices including
Spring Design's Alex Reader.
